The Little Kindy Muswellbrook team has been working with the New South Wales Department of Education’s  Quality Support Program – Compliance Support Pathway to strengthen their practice and regulatory compliance.

 

The Compliance Support Pathway is a free 6-week tailored program that aims to assist services remedy non-compliant practices and behaviours. 

 

It is one of 2 pathways in the Quality Support Program (QSP), a professional learning initiative run in partnership between ACECQA and the NSW Department of Education. The QSP supports early childhood education and care approved providers and service leaders to better understand and apply the Children (Education and Care Services) National Law (NSW) and Education and Care Services National Regulations.

 

Access to the Quality Support Program – Compliance Support Pathway is by direct referral from the NSW Department of Education, and current Little Kindy Director Nicole Douglas had only recently taken over the role when her service was invited to participate in the program in late 2023.

 

“Being new to the role of director in the centre, I thought it would be a fantastic opportunity to reflect and gain knowledge to share with my team in an effort to maintain compliant practices,” she said.

 

“The program was a great and very informative experience. I had weekly Zoom meetings with my facilitator, Amanda, as well as corresponding with her via email.”

 

Little Kindy Muswellbrook, a long day care service located in the NSW Hunter region, was referred to the program due to breaches relating to children’s health and safety, governance and management.

 

“Amanda was a wealth of knowledge,” Ms Douglas said. “I was given many ideas, chances to reflect on our current and past practices, as well as links to valuable resources.”

 

Alongside coaching and face-to face visits, participants in the program also have access to online training modules and workshops.

 

Reflection supports continuous improvement

 

Reflective practice is a key focus of the program, Ms Douglas explained.

 

“I was encouraged to look into our current practices and unpack them,” she said. “It is something I continue to encourage my team to do, as I have learned how important reflective practices are to ensure we are continually improving and being the best that we can be.”

 

“Staff reflect daily through discussion as well as monthly in our team meetings. This reflection is documented in reflective journals and has become second nature to the educators now that they are doing it more frequently and continually improving practices.”

 

Since being part of the program, Ms Douglas has made a conscious effort to have many open discussions with staff, so they are empowered to take initiative and provide feedback and ideas.”

 

Overall, the Compliance Support Pathway was a worthwhile experience for her and the broader team.

 

“The positive experience I had while completing the Compliance Support Pathway has shown my team that the NSW Department of Education is there to work with us, not against us,” she said. “It really helped remove some stigma attached.”

 

“If services are presented with the opportunity to participate in the Compliance Support Pathway, they should definitely participate.”

 

“In my experience, I found it to be very informative and non-judgemental – a safe space for open communication and honesty.”

 

How can I participate?

 

Access to the Quality Support Program – Compliance Support Pathway is by direct referral from the NSW Department of Education.

 

The department uses regulatory data to identify services that will benefit the most from the support offered in the Compliance Support Pathway. Once referred, a program facilitator from ACECQA will contact services about enrolling into the pathway program.

 

Services can also express interest in participating in the pathway by emailing [email protected]
